You've done all the steps which I would have tried, if those have not changed the behaviour of the device then it's almost certainly not recoverable. I guess the flash memory has failed, but since the components on the circuit board are not replaceable, economically it's not worth trying to isolate the fault.
------------------------------
Norman Smart
------------------------------